Abstract :
This study investigated the relationship between Useful Field of View and simulator -driving performance measure s. Ninety profe ssional dr ivers, aged 22-65 years from several gove rnmen t organizat ions vo luntarily participated at this study. Useful Field of View was measured by a computerized task was developed at the present study . The participant s then performed a driv ing simu lator task and expe rienced a scenario that could lead to an accident. Reaction time and spe ed were measured and recorded by simulator and ge neral driving performance and collision events were recorded by examiner. The reduction of Useful Field of View based on subject s err or score on Useful Fie ld of View subtests between young and old group stat istically was analyzed. Correlation analyses used to examine the relationship amo ng the Use ful Field of View as an independent variable and driving performance measures as a dependent variab les. A univar iate logistic regression ana lysis was used to determine the extent to which red uction of Useful Field of View predict s risk of accident in simulated car drivi ng. There was a signific ant and nega tive correlation be twee n Useful Field of View and simulator performance, on the div ided peripheral subtest (Correlation Coeffic ient=-0.28 ). Stud ent s t-tests revealed significant differences in peripheral scores of Useful Field of View subtests between accident involved and non- involved gro ups. The resu lt of logistic regr ession indicated that 40% reduction of Useful Field of View, reg ardless of age, increased risk of acc ident involvement. Use ful Fie ld of View coul d be used to predict driving performance and risk of accident. The obtained result can help to identify a high risk driver which is useful to licen sing authorities .
